在Linux系統上使用CLion進行跨平臺C/C++開發的配置技巧

linux系統上使用clion進行跨平臺c/c++開發的配置技巧

CLion是一款功能強大的跨平臺集成開發環境(ide),它能夠幫助開發者高效地開發C/C++項目。本文將介紹如何在Linux系統上配置CLion,以便進行跨平臺的C/C++開發,并附帶代碼示例。

一、安裝CLion
首先,我們需要下載并安裝CLion。可以在JetBrains官網上下載到最新版本的CLion。下載完成后,使用以下命令進行安裝:

tar -xzf CLion-*.tar.gz cd clion-*/bin ./clion.sh

二、創建C/C++項目

  1. 打開CLion后,選擇“Create New Project”。
  2. 在“New Project”窗口中,選擇“C Executable”或“C++ Executable”項目類型,點擊“Next”按鈕。
  3. 在“Project Name”欄中輸入項目名稱,選擇項目保存的路徑,然后點擊“Next”。
  4. 在“Toolchains”選項中,選擇你的編譯器。如果你已經安裝了GCC或者Clang,CLion會自動檢測到它們,你只需要選擇正確的工具鏈。
  5. 點擊“Next”和“Finish”按鈕,CLion將自動生成一個C/C++項目的基本框架。

三、配置文件包含路徑
有時候,我們需要在項目中包含一些特定的文件或庫。為了使編譯器正確地找到這些文件或庫,我們需要配置文件包含路徑。在CLion中,這可以通過以下步驟完成:

立即學習C++免費學習筆記(深入)”;

  1. 打開“File”菜單,選擇“Settings”。
  2. 在“Settings”窗口中選擇“Build, Execution, Deployment -> CMake”。
  3. 在“CMake”選項卡中,在“CMake options”欄中輸入以下內容:

    -DCMAKE_include_PATH=/path/to/include

    將”/path/to/include”替換為你需要包含的文件或庫的路徑。如果有多個路徑,使用分號將它們分隔開。

  4. 點擊“Apply”和“OK”按鈕,CLion將重新加載CMake并配置新的文件包含路徑。

四、配置預處理器
有時候,我們需要根據不同的平臺或編譯配置,啟用或禁用不同的預處理器宏。在CLion中,可以通過以下步驟完成:

  1. 打開“File”菜單,選擇“Settings”。
  2. 在“Settings”窗口中選擇“Build, Execution, Deployment -> CMake”。
  3. 在“CMake”選項卡中,在“CMake options”欄中輸入以下內容:

    -DDEFINE_MACRO

    將“DEFINE_MACRO”替換為你想要定義的預處理器宏的名稱。如果有多個宏,使用分號將它們分隔開。

  4. 點擊“Apply”和“OK”按鈕,CLion將重新加載CMake并配置新的預處理器宏。

五、配置調試器
在CLion中,可以使用GDB作為默認的調試器。要配置調試器,可以按照以下步驟進行:

  1. 打開“File”菜單,選擇“Settings”。
  2. 在“Settings”窗口中選擇“Build, Execution, Deployment -> Toolchains”。
  3. 在“Debugger”選項卡中,選擇“GDB”作為默認調試器,并配置GDB所需的路徑。
  4. 點擊“Apply”和“OK”按鈕,CLion將重新加載調試器配置。

六、示例代碼
下面是一個簡單的示例代碼,演示了如何在CLion中使用CMake進行C/C++項目的跨平臺開發:

#include <stdio.h>  int main() {     printf("Hello, CLion! ");     return 0; }</stdio.h>

七、總結
通過本文所介紹的配置技巧,我們可以在Linux系統上更方便地使用CLion進行跨平臺的C/C++開發。通過設置文件包含路徑、預處理器宏和調試器,可以有效提高開發效率。同時,配合CLion強大的代碼編輯和調試功能,我們能夠更輕松地進行C/C++項目開發。

希望本文能對你在Linux上使用CLion進行C/C++開發的配置有所幫助!

? 版權聲明
THE END
喜歡就支持一下吧
點贊7 分享